How they compare

Djibouti currently reports 171 m3 against 165 m3 in Tonga, a difference of 6 m3.

The two have swapped places 7 times across 20 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Tonga ahead.

Djibouti ranks 130th and Tonga ranks 131st of 159 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Djibouti averaged higher in 2 and Tonga in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Djibouti Tonga Difference Ahead
1990s 125 m3 29 m3 96 m3 Djibouti
2000s 138.38 m3 59.75 m3 78.62 m3 Djibouti
2010s 72.89 m3 2,818 m3 2,745 m3 Tonga

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
